New Delhi. Rakesh Jhunjhunwala, who was called the ‘Big Bull’ of the stock market, passed away on Sunday morning. His age was 62 years. According to news agency ANI, he breathed his last at Breach Candy Hospital in Mumbai. The whole country is saddened by the death of Rakesh Jhunjhunwala. He had explained to millions of people how to invest in the stock market. Prime Minister Narendra Modi himself has also expressed grief over his death. At the same time, the veterans of the game are also mourning the death of this juggler of the stock market. Former India opener Virender Sehwag has expressed grief over the demise of this veteran personality by tweeting. According to reports, he was running ill for a long time. He was last seen at a public event at the opening ceremony of Akasa Air.

On the death of Rakesh Jhunjhunwala, Sehwag tweeted, ‘End of an era as the Big Bull of Dalal Street, Rakesh Jhunjhunwala passed away. Condolences to his family and close ones. Oh peace.

He was counted among the top 500 billionaires in the world. With a net worth of $5.5 billion, Jhunjhunwala was considered one of the most successful Indian investors. A chartered accountant by profession, Jhunjhunwala was the chairperson of Hungama Media and Aptech. He was also a board member of several Indian companies.

He started investing in the stock market when he was in college. At that time the BSE index was around 150 points and Jhunjhunwala started investing with just Rs 5000. However, this amount was too much for that time. Now Rakesh Jhunjhunwala’s net worth was around Rs.39 thousand crores. In 1987, Rakesh Jhunjhunwala married Rekha Jhunjhunwala. She was also an investor in the stock market. The duo later started their own stock trading firm Rare Enterprises in 2003.
